Webster

mortuary (a.)

A sort of ecclesiastical heriot, a customary gift claimed by, and due to, the minister of a parish on the death of a parishioner. It seems to have been originally a voluntary bequest or donation, intended to make amends for any failure in the payment of tithes of which the deceased had been guilty.

A burial place; a place for the dead.

A place for the reception of the dead before burial; a deadhouse; a morgue.

Of or pertaining to the dead; as, mortuary monuments.
